F17B/0021 is a planning application to Fingal County Council for single storey extension to rear of existing dwelling together with new, received on 17 Feb 2017; permission was granted on 10 Apr 2017.

Zoning at the site

RS - Residential: Ensure that any new development in existing areas would have a minimal impact on and enhance existing residential amenity.

R2 — Existing residential

RS - Residential: Provide for residential development and protect and improve residential amenity

An established residential area. The objective is to protect existing residential amenity as well as to provide housing — which is the objective a neighbour's objection to an overbearing extension is usually argued under.
